About Starknet
Starknet stands as a permissionless blockchain solution, functioning as a Validity-Rollup, often referred to as a zero-knowledge rollup (ZK rollup) for Ethereum. It's a Layer 2 (L2) platform that empowers dApps to achieve significant computational scalability while upholding Ethereum's inherent composability and security standards.
About Tron
Tron is a blockchain platform focused on decentralized entertainment and content distribution. It offers high throughput, supports dApps, and uses the TRX token for transactions and governance. Tron aims to disrupt traditional entertainment industries by providing a platform for content creators to distribute and monetize their content directly to consumers.
